溫馨提示×

Java程序Ubuntu上編譯失敗原因

小樊
40
2025-05-17 23:48:12
欄目: 編程語言

在Ubuntu上編譯Java程序時,可能會遇到多種問題。為了幫助您解決問題,請提供更多關于錯誤的詳細信息,例如錯誤消息、代碼片段或您正在使用的命令。這將有助于我為您提供更具體的解決方案。

然而,這里有一些建議,可以幫助您解決在Ubuntu上編譯Java程序時可能遇到的一些常見問題:

  1. 確保已安裝Java Development Kit (JDK)。您可以使用以下命令安裝OpenJDK:
sudo apt update
sudo apt install openjdk-11-jdk
  1. 檢查JAVA_HOME環境變量是否已設置為正確的JDK安裝路徑。您可以使用以下命令找到JAVA_HOME:
echo $JAVA_HOME

如果未設置JAVA_HOME,請使用以下命令設置(根據您的JDK安裝路徑進行修改):

export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
export PATH=$PATH:$JAVA_HOME/bin
  1. 確保您的Java代碼沒有語法錯誤。使用javac命令編譯Java文件,例如:
javac HelloWorld.java

如果代碼中存在錯誤,javac將顯示錯誤消息。根據錯誤消息修復代碼,然后再次嘗試編譯。

  1. 如果您使用的是第三方庫,請確保已將它們添加到類路徑中。使用-cp-classpath選項指定類路徑,例如:
javac -cp .:/path/to/library.jar HelloWorld.java
  1. 如果您使用的是Maven或Gradle等構建工具,請確保已正確安裝和配置它們。這些工具通常會自動處理依賴關系和編譯過程。

如果您能提供更多關于錯誤的詳細信息,我將更好地幫助您解決問題。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女